Understanding Common Conservatory Issues

Before diving into repair solutions, it's important to understand the typical issues that conservatories face. Here are a few of the most regular problems:

  1. Leaky Roof: Water infiltration can trigger significant damage to the conservatory and your home's interior.
  2. Broken Windows: Cracked or shattered glass can jeopardize the conservatory's safety and energy effectiveness.
  3. Structural Damage: Over time, the frame and support structures can compromise, causing stability issues.
  4. Sealing and Insulation: Poor seals and insulation can result in drafts and increased energy costs.
  5. Furniture and Fittings: Damage to internal fittings and furniture can diminish the conservatory's aesthetic appeal and functionality.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q: How often should I inspect my conservatory for damage?

A: It's a good idea to check your conservatory at least once a year. This can help you recognize and resolve issues before they end up being more severe and costly to fix.

Q: Can I repair a leaky roof myself?

A: Minor leaks can frequently be repaired with a top quality sealant. Nevertheless, for more serious leaks, it's best to seek advice from a professional to ensure the repair is done properly and securely.

Q: What are the indications of structural damage in a conservatory?

A: Signs of structural damage consist of fractures in the frame, warping, and weakening. If you discover any of these issues, it's important to resolve them immediately to avoid further damage.

Q: How can I enhance the insulation in my conservatory?

A: Adding weather removing, sealing gaps with broadening foam, and insulating the roof can all assist improve insulation and decrease energy costs.
